How are Cinnamon roll and Danish pastry different?

  • Cinnamon roll is higher in Calcium, Vitamin K, and Vitamin E , however, Danish pastry is richer in Selenium, Vitamin B2, and Iron.
  • Daily need coverage for Saturated Fat from Cinnamon roll is 29% higher.
  • Cinnamon roll contains 5 times more Calcium than Danish pastry. While Cinnamon roll contains 183mg of Calcium, Danish pastry contains only 35mg.
  • Danish pastry has less Saturated Fat.

Cinnamon buns, frosted (includes honey buns) and Danish pastry, cheese are the varieties used in this article.

Comparison summary

Which food is lower in Sugar?
Danish pastry
Danish pastry is lower in Sugar (difference - 18.75g)
Which food is lower in Saturated Fat?
Danish pastry
Danish pastry is lower in Saturated Fat (difference - 5.855g)
Which food is richer in minerals?
Danish pastry
Danish pastry is relatively richer in minerals
Which food contains less Sodium?
Cinnamon roll
Cinnamon roll contains less Sodium (difference - 112mg)
Which food is lower in Cholesterol?
Cinnamon roll
Cinnamon roll is lower in Cholesterol (difference - 18mg)
Which food is lower in glycemic index?
Cinnamon roll
Cinnamon roll is lower in glycemic index (difference - 10)
